If you’re a Skilled Speech Therapist curious about Travel job trends in Belen, NM,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 4 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$1,786 and a range from $1,552 to $2,172 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.
Positions were located in key zip codes, including 87002, at reputable facilities such as Belen Meadows Healthcare and Rehabilitation Center. Currently, most Skilled Speech & Language Pathology travel jobs in Belen, New Mexico, require candidates to hold a valid state license and possess at least one to two years of clinical experience in various settings, such as schools or rehabilitation facilities. Additionally, experience with a diverse patient population and familiarity with the latest assessment tools and therapeutic techniques are preferred.
Skilled Speech & Language Pathology travel jobs in Belen, New Mexico, are typically available at healthcare facilities such as hospitals and rehabilitation centers, as well as outpatient clinics that provide therapy services. These settings often seek experienced professionals to address a variety of communication and swallowing disorders in diverse patient populations.
For Skilled Speech & Language Pathology Travel jobs in Belen, NM, typical contract durations range from 1-8 weeks, 9-12 weeks, and 13 weeks. These flexible contract lengths allow you to choose an assignment that best fits your career goals and lifestyle preferences.
